Wenlin is CD-ROM software for the MS-Windows operating systems. Wenlin tackles the most frustrating obstacles for students, scholars, and speakers of Chinese with its versatile and easy-to-use interface. It is like having a seasoned scholar on your desktop! An integrated solution, Wenlin combines a high-speed expandable Chinese dictionary, a full-featured text editor, and unique “flashcard” system all in one intuitive environment.
Wenlin v.3.3.6 includes an expanded and improved version of the already huge ABC Chinese-English Dictionary edited by John DeFrancis, giving it a total of over 10,000 characters and approximately 200,000 words and phrases.
